Projeto JAR para base de um projeto WAR
Pessoal, estou com uma dúvida se foi a melhor opção eu um projeto que criei.Precisava desenvolver um projeto web com Java, no início criei as classes bases no mesmo projeto web (Classes para heranças: BaseAbstractMB, BaseAbstractDAO). Depois de um tempo, precisei criar outro projeto web Java, então resolvi tirar essas classes bases e criar em outro projeto separado, assim eu poderia usar as mesmas classes nos dois projetos. Para isso, eu criei um projeto JAR e criei toda a estrutura das classes bases lá e nos meus projetos web adicionei a dependência (arquivo pom.xml) do projeto JAR.
1
2
3
4
5
<dependency>
<groupId>br.com.projetobase</groupId>
<artifactId>medconbase</artifactId>
<version>1.0.0</version>
</dependency>
Resumindo, nos meus projetos web(WAR) eu tenho a dependência do projeto JAR (que contém toda a estrutura base para os projetos). Enfim, minha dúvida é, é errado fazer isso? É comum fazer desta maneira? O que podem me dizer sobre isso?Discussão (0)
Carregando comentários...